Small Japanese restaurant offers an open kitchen where chefs prepare okonomiyaki, creating an engaging dining experience. The atmosphere feels authentic and welcoming, with modern, clean interiors and a unique ceiling design. It becomes lively and crowded on weekends, with close tables and occasional loudness.

Okonomiyaki here matches the style found in Japan, including Hiroshima-style with marinated beef and spicy flavors. Takoyaki features big octopus chunks with a crispy outside and gooey center, while karaage comes as large chicken thigh pieces topped with green onions, ponzu, and mayo.

Fried oysters come large with good quality meat. The seafood okonomiyaki features perfectly cooked squid and shrimp. Oysters served include Goam and B&C varieties, all very tasty.

Massive supermarket with a mini mall inside offers a bustling food court, live seafood section, and specialty shops like a K-pop and Hello Kitty store. Narrow aisles and a crowded, lively atmosphere fill the space, especially on weekends. Fresh produce, unique Asian fruits, and a French Korean bakery stand out among diverse Asian groceries.

Fresh sushi and ingredients sit alongside a world class meat market and refrigerated mochi under $10. Ramen tastes delicious, and shumai bags go for about $10 each.

Fresh fish and seafood include pompano, large red shrimp, and unique fish balls not found elsewhere. Plenty of options come with a 30% discount on seafood during weekday evenings.
